#!/usr/bin/env python
# pylint: disable=unused-argument
# This program is dedicated to the public domain under the CC0 license.

"""
Simple Bot to reply to Telegram messages.

First, a few handler functions are defined. Then, those functions are passed to
the Application and registered at their respective places.
Then, the bot is started and runs until we press Ctrl-C on the command line.

Usage:
Basic Echobot example, repeats messages.
Press Ctrl-C on the command line or send a signal to the process to stop the
bot.
"""

import logging

from telegram import ForceReply, Update
from telegram.ext import Application, CommandHandler, ContextTypes, MessageHandler, filters
from todobot.config import TELEGRAM_TOKEN

# Enable logging
logging.basicConfig(
format="%(asctime)s - %(name)s - %(levelname)s - %(message)s", level=logging.INFO
)
# set higher logging level for httpx to avoid all GET and POST requests being logged
logging.getLogger("httpx").setLevel(logging.WARNING)

logger = logging.getLogger(__name__)


# Define a few command handlers. These usually take the two arguments update and
# context.
async def start(update: Update, context: ContextTypes.DEFAULT_TYPE) -> None:
"""Send a message when the command /start is issued."""
user = update.effective_user
await update.message.reply_text(
'Hello, Rust!'
)


async def help_command(update: Update, context: ContextTypes.DEFAULT_TYPE) -> None:
"""Send a message when the command /help is issued."""
await update.message.reply_text("Help!")


async def echo(update: Update, context: ContextTypes.DEFAULT_TYPE) -> None:
"""Echo the user message."""
await update.message.reply_text(update.message.text)


def main() -> None:
"""Start the bot."""
# Create the Application and pass it your bot's token.
application = Application.builder().token(TELEGRAM_TOKEN).build()

# on different commands - answer in Telegram
application.add_handler(CommandHandler("start", start))
application.add_handler(CommandHandler("help", help_command))

# on non command i.e message - echo the message on Telegram
application.add_handler(MessageHandler(filters.TEXT & ~filters.COMMAND, echo))

# Run the bot until the user presses Ctrl-C
application.run_polling(allowed_updates=Update.ALL_TYPES)


if __name__ == "__main__":
main()
